Skip to main content

SourceAccessService

Trait SourceAccessService 

Source
pub trait SourceAccessService: Debug {
    // Provided method
    fn get_source_span(
        &self,
        _config_args: &SqlFunArgs,
        source_path: &Path,
        span: StringSpan,
    ) -> Result<String, AnalysisError> { ... }
}
Expand description

provide access to source SQL file

Provided Methods§

Source

fn get_source_span( &self, _config_args: &SqlFunArgs, source_path: &Path, span: StringSpan, ) -> Result<String, AnalysisError>

Get source span as String

Implementors§